About the Book

What if matter is not solid, but alive with intelligence?

In The Consciousness Of The Atom, Alice A. Bailey presents one of the most striking metaphysical inquiries of the early twentieth century: that every form in the universe-from the tiniest particle of substance to the vast structure of a solar system-may be understood as a living centre of consciousness evolving through stages of awareness.

This Seeker's Annotated Edition includes:

  • 35 Bridging Reflections thoughtfully woven through Bailey's lectures, translating key ideas into modern scientific and philosophical perspectives.
  • 30 Guided Inquiries at the close of each lecture, offering contemplative questions and practices to help readers apply Bailey's concepts to their own lives.
  • 8 original poetic transmissions, introducing each of Bailey's seven lectures and concluding the book with a final reflection that honours The Consciousness Of The Atom as the gateway to her later works.

Written in the language of its time yet remarkably resonant with contemporary scientific imagination, Bailey explores a universe built not from inert matter, but from energy, relationship, and evolving awareness. Using the principle of analogy, she traces a continuum of consciousness linking atom, human being, planet, and cosmos within a single living system.

Rather than presenting fixed doctrine, these lectures invite inquiry. They ask whether intelligence, love, and will are separate forces-or expressions of a deeper unity unfolding through every form of life.

For today's reader, The Consciousness Of The Atom offers a contemplative bridge between science, philosophy, and spiritual exploration. Themes such as group consciousness, radioactivity as a symbol of spiritual expansion, and the evolution of awareness beyond the personal self are presented as invitations to reflection rather than beliefs to accept.

Alice A. Bailey (1880-1949) is renowned for her exploration of consciousness, energy, and the hidden structure of reality. Her writings continue to influence students of metaphysics, spiritual philosophy, and transpersonal psychology.

This annotated edition preserves the integrity of Bailey's original lectures while offering thoughtful editorial guidance to illuminate their symbolic and philosophical depth.

The Consciousness Of The Atom ultimately asks a timeless question:

What if the universe is not something we live in-but something becoming conscious through us?



About the Author :
Alice A. Bailey (1880-1949), a writer in the field of esoteric philosophy, is known for exploring the relationship between consciousness, energy, and the structure of reality. Her work continues to influence modern metaphysical thought, integrative psychology, and spiritual philosophy. Danni Tomczynski is a healer, intuitive, and artist whose work bridges body, mind, and soul, exploring the subtle interplay of consciousness, form, and healing. Her path was shaped through a deep initiation via chronic, unresolved illness, leading her into the study of esoteric teachings, including the works of Alice Bailey, and into the cultivation of intuitive perception through the Akashic Records, shamanic journeying, psychic and mediumship development, and biodynamic craniosacral therapy.This lived inquiry deepened her understanding of consciousness, the nervous system, and the body's innate capacity for healing, revealing the body as an expression of a greater field of intelligence-where matter and spirit exist in continuous dialogue. Through her work, she supports the restoration of inner coherence and attunement, guiding others to reconnect with their own rhythm, inner intelligence, and evolutionary path.
